摘要
Photoluminescence (PL) was observed from micelles of polypyrrole without substituent groups. CHCI3 and CCI4 as well as 2,2,6,6-tetramethyl-1-piperidinyloxy (TEMPO) showed a typical fluorescence quenching behavior that can be observed when quencher molecules are added to a micellar solution of fluorescent material. At higher concentrations, the PL intensity decreased due to quenching in the aggregate phase and self-absorption. The PL intensity,varied depending upon the solvent in the order of dimethyl sulfoxide (DMSO) > N,N-dimethylformamide (DMF) > N-methyl-2-pyrrolidinone (NMP) > ethanol > toluene > tetrahydrofuran (THF).
